COLLINGWOOD, ON, Aug. 7, 2018 /CNW/ - Collingwood's harbour festival is back with more ways to have fun in this historic, harbourfront downtown.
On August 11 and 12, Sidelaunch Days celebrates the joy of being in, on, and around South Georgian Bay while commemorating the unique shipbuilding heritage of Collingwood. With activities for all ages, Sidelaunch Days is a great family festival.
Getting out on the water is a big part of Sidelaunch Days. Visitors can try out canoeing, kayaking, sailing and stand up paddle-boarding for free! They can also catch the excitement by watching the experts compete, or even compete themselves!
The Ontario Summer Splash SUP Race Series stops in Collingwood featuring demos and races. From novice events to sprints, team races on Blu Wave's giant SUP, to the new race out to the Nottawasaga Lighthouse and back, there's something for every paddler.
Cable wakeboarding is back, starting the week BEFORE Sidelaunch Days. Try wakeboarding in the beautiful, safe, and protected Collingwood Harbour August 6-10, 10 a.m. to 6 p.m. daily. The team at Border Pass make it easy, but they also offer a Get Up Guarantee or it's free!
New this year is the addition of Battle in the Bay, an amateur and pro wakeboarding competition. Experience the thrill and be astounded by the sweet flips and crazy tricks they perform.
There's more free fun and activities:
- Stroll the Market Promenade beside the sidelaunch basin: There's something for everyone along the eats, treats and art promenade, featuring more than 25 vendors
- Visit the Kids Craft & Activity Centre: Enjoy arts and crafts for children including balsa wood planes. Take your plane to the Wooden Airplane Flight Zone and test its abilities in the Longest Flight Challenge.
- Be a Sailor for a Day in a Watercraft Simulator: Incredible watercraft simulator that makes you feel like you are sailing a Great Lakes Freighter – even one like those that used to 'sidelaunch' into Collingwood harbour.
- Watch Kites over Collingwood at Millennium Park: Participants can bring their own kites or decorate one on site and enjoy the winds at Millennium. Watch the professionals with their large colourful kites soaring high above Collingwood Harbour!
- Evening concerts at the Shipyards Amphitheatre: Bring your own chair, concerts start at 7:00 p.m.! Saturday features the Jayden Grahlman Band while the Mudmen return on Sunday.
